Infection with phocine herpesvirus type-1 (PHV-1) has been associated with morbidity and high mortality in neonatal harbor seals (Phoca vitulina). A PHV-1 specific indirect enzyme linked immunosorbent assay (ELISA) was developed to sequentially measure the serological status of 106 harbor seal neonates admitted to a Pacific coast rehabilitation center (total number of sera tested was 371). Early in the season (February-April), the majority of pups had low serum levels of PHV-1 specific antibody. A dramatic increase in PHV-1 specific antibody, involving the majority of hospitalized pups, was observed during a 4-week period in May. This coincided with a high incidence of PHV-1 associated adrenal lesions and mortality. Although there was overall agreement between the timing of seroconversion to PHV-1 and histological evidence of PHV-1 infection, 82.4% of individual pups with adrenalitis had no evidence of a humoral response to PHV-1 at the time of their death. This suggests either a rapid disease course, or an inability to develop a humoral response in some neonatal seals.
